Amma ("mother") is an Indian housewife and grandmother who began posting recipes for her children on the Internet when they moved overseas and missed her cooking. From this simple beginning in 1996, Ammas.com has grown to be the worlds largest and most successful Asian food and lifestyle Web site, audited at more than 2 million hits per month. Demand for a cookbook from site users has led to this superb collection of genuine Indian recipes adapted for international use. These include traditional vegetarian, chicken, lamb, and game dishes, vegetables, dals, rices, breads, and seafood. Let Amma introduce you to crayfish in a creamy curry, stuffed eggplant, golden fried coconut rice, cashew nut curry, and other exquisite new dishes and exotic flavors you can create at home. Recipes are presented in easy-to-follow steps, with explanations of Indian spices, flavorings, and cooking techniques, and every dish is photographed in color. Amma also provides delightful anecdotes of Indian village life, which convey the warmth, love, and traditional values of her upbringing. Not a book for chefs, full of recipes you might find in an Indian restaurant, instead Amma offers recipes for cooks, with food from a mothers kitchen. This book brings together 500 authentic recipes for every part of the Indian meal, from spicy appetizers, deliciously rich and creamy curries and vegetarian dishes to all the classic breads, rices and side dishes, sumptuous desserts and popular drinks. Every Indian favorite is featured, including Chicken Tikka, Beef Madras. Lamb with Spinach, Fish Jhalfrazi, Curried Chickpeas, Saffron Rice, Lassi (Spiced Yogurt) and Kulfi (Indian Ice Cream). There are also more unusual recipes to try, such as Balti Chicken with Panir and Peas, Lahore-style Lamb, Prawn and Spinach Pancakes, Stuffed Aubergines in Seasoned Tamarind Juice, and Almond Sherbet. From Pakistan to Burma and beyond, there is an incredible variety of dishes and cooking styles represented in the book. With every recipe photographed in its finished form, and clear step-by-step instructions to ensure success, this is an essential collection of recipes for all lovers of Indian food.



Indian Famine Codes - The Indian Famine Codes, developed by the colonial British in the 1880s, were one of the earliest famine scales. The Famine Codes defined three levels of food insecurity: near-scarcity, scarcity, and famine.

Puri (food) - A puri or poori is an Indian unleavened bread made from a dough of atta (whole grain durum wheat flour), water and salt by rolling it out into discs of approximately 12 cm diameter and deep frying it in ghee or vegetable oil. Traditionally served in South Asia (India, Pakistan, Bangladesh, Sri Lanka) it is best eaten if it is served immediately.
